Ingredients You'll Need

Ingredients You’ll Need

  • 2 lb strawberries, hulled and sliced
  • 1 pint blueberries
  • 8 ounces mozzarella pearls, drained
  •  Handful of fresh basil, chiffonade
  • 2 tablespoons honey
  • 2 tablespoons balsamic vinegar
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ground black pepper

Instructions

1. Prep your ingredients: clean, hull, and slice the strawberries. Drain the mozzarella pearls. Chiffonade the basil.
2. In a small bowl, whisk together honey, balsamic vinegar, olive oil, salt, and pepper until well combined.
3. In a large bowl, combine the strawberries, blueberries, mozzarella pearls, and basil.
4. Pour the dressing on top of the salad and toss gently to combine. Allow it to stand for 15 minutes before serving.
Notes:
For a twist, you can add a sprinkle of chopped nuts like walnuts or pecans for extra crunch.

Tips for an Easy Caprese Salad Recipe

Making a tasty balsamic strawberry caprese salad is easy. Here are some key tips to make your salad both delicious and beautiful.

Begin by picking fresh ingredients. Choose strawberries that are bright red and have no spots. They should be slightly soft when you press them, showing they’re ripe. Mozzarella should be soft and moist, adding to the flavor mix.

For the best look, cut your strawberries and mozzarella into the same size pieces. This makes the salad look good and ensures everything is evenly spread. Use a sharp knife to avoid squishing the ingredients.

When you mix the salad, be gentle. Don’t toss it too hard, or it will get mushy. Instead, layer the ingredients carefully. Drizzle the strawberry balsamic salad with balsamic glaze right before serving to keep everything fresh and flavorful.

To serve, arrange the salad in a way that looks good. Mixing colors and shapes can make a simple salad into a beautiful centerpiece for any meal.

Variations to Try for a Unique Flavor

Trying different versions can make your Strawberry Caprese salad even better. You’ll love adding seasonal fruits and new dressings to it. Here are some tasty ways to change up your salad.

Adding Other Fruits to Your Salad

Adding other fruits can give your salad a fresh twist. Think about adding:

  • Peaches: Their sweetness goes well with strawberries.
  • Nectarines: The tartness matches the creamy mozzarella.
  • Mango: This tropical fruit adds an exotic taste.
  • Blueberries: They add a burst of flavor and color.

Alternative Dressings to Consider

Changing the dressing can really change the taste. Try these different dressings:

  • Citrus vinaigrette: It’s bright and zesty, making the fruits sweeter.
  • Herbed balsamic reduction: Fresh herbs in your balsamic add a rich flavor.
  • Honey mustard dressing: It’s sweet and spicy, balancing the balsamic.
  • Avocado oil with lime: It’s creamy and refreshing.

Storing Leftover Balsamic Strawberry Caprese Recipe

To keep your strawberry balsamic salad fresh, store leftovers in an airtight container. This stops air from spoiling the ingredients and keeps the flavors bright. It’s best to eat your salad within 2 to 3 days for the best taste and texture.

For the best storage, follow these tips:

  • Chop strawberries and basil just before serving. This keeps them fresh longer.
  • Put individual servings in small containers for enjoying throughout the week.
  • If you prep ahead, layer the dressing at the bottom. Add the salad on top to avoid sogginess.
